Tatsumi Textiles is a location in the Persona series.

Profile

Tatsumi Textiles is a textile and fabric store currently run by Kanji Tatsumi's mother. It is also their family home. The shop has been around since the Meiji period when people in Inaba began dyeing textiles using the clean streams of the Samegawa. The previous owner was Kanji's father, who died in an accident and was said to have been known throughout the country as a famous dyer.[1] Yukiko Amagi and her family are acquaintances of the Tatsumi family, and they buy fabrics from Tatsumi Textiles that are used as dyed souvenirs for guests of the Amagi Inn.[2]

Game Appearances

Persona 4

The store is visited during the story on May 16th. After the Investigation Team sees a figure resembling Kanji on the Midnight Channel, they pay a visit to his family's store to ask about him. When the group arrives, Naoto Shirogane is on the way out, having also been asking Kanji's mother about her son. Before Yukiko can ask about Kanji, Chie Satonaka spots a red scarf that reminds her and Yosuke Hanamura of the noose they saw in the Desolate Bedroom. Kanji's mother explains that Mayumi Yamano had ordered a matching pair of scarves for a man and a woman, but in the end, she only purchased the woman's scarf, and now the store is selling the man's scarf.

During Kanji's Emperor Social Link, he begins knitting dolls and tells his mother that she can sell them in the family store.

Persona 4 Golden

The group takes Marie to Tatsumi Textiles to ask Kanji's mom about the bamboo comb that Marie carries.

Persona 4 Arena

During the intro to Kanji's story mode, he begins knitting a gift for Yu Narukami in the living room but mistakenly falls into the family's large screen TV and winds up getting involved in the P-1 Grand Prix. In the ending, Kanji tends to the store and admires the shelves of his knit animals.

Persona 4 Arena Ultimax

In the Epilogue of Episode P4, Kanji is shown studying English in the living room. Additionally, he has begun thinking about inheriting the family the business and practicing dyeing fabrics in secret.
